A key element of the Uninterrupted Power Supply (UPS) system is its battery, which supplies power in times of outages. Effective UPS battery management is vital to ensure system dependability. This article introduces a groundbreaking technique for UPS battery supervision using remote monitoring via the Simple Network Management Protocol (SNMP). The suggested method utilizes SNMP to remotely supervise and control UPS battery parameters, enabling real-time monitoring of battery voltage levels, current consumption, temperature, and other essential metrics without the need for physical presence. Proactive identification of potential battery issues, such as low charge levels or unusual temperature fluctuations, can be achieved through SNMP traps and queries. }, keywords = {}, month = {}, }
